Steven Gerrard sent off 48 seconds after coming on against Manchester United

Liverpool midfielder Steven Gerrard is sent off less than a minute after coming on as a substitute in his final appearance against Manchester United.

Liverpool midfielder Steven Gerrard has been sent off less than a minute after coming on as a half-time substitute against Manchester United at Anfield.

The Reds talisman came on at the break of the crunch Premier League clash as a replacement for Adam Lallana, who appeared to be withdrawn with an injury.

Within 48 seconds of the restart, however, Gerrard was shown a red card by the referee for stamping on Ander Herrera's shin, leaving his side to fight on against their great rivals with 10 men.

This will likely be Gerrard's last ever appearance against United ahead of his summer move to Los Angeles Galaxy.

Man Utd went on to beat Liverpool 2-1.
